SINGAPORE - Social media cheered the ephemeral appearance of a double rainbow that spanned the skies of Singapore after a light shower on Wednesday morning.

"Starting the day with a rainbow in the sky! Gonna be a good one! ," wrote Twitter user, Chay Chee.

The rainbow was sighted mostly in the western and northwestern parts of the island.

In Chinese culture, a double rainbow is considered auspicious and a reason for reflection and meditation.

Rainbows are an optical and meteorological phenomenon in which a spectrum of light appears in the sky when the sun shines on droplets of moisture in the earth’s atmosphere.
